Yokogawa Electric Corporation recently announced it has secured contracts from Kawasaki Heavy Industries, Ltd. to equip two new hydrogen-fueled vessels with integrated automation systems. Additionally, Yokogawa will supply a similar system for a 40,000 cubic meter liquefied hydrogen carrier, which is anticipated to be the largest vessel of its kind globally.
The scope of supply for the hydrogen-fueled vessels includes a marine hydrogen fuel system (MHFS), comprising liquefied hydrogen tanks and associated fuel supply equipment. For the liquefied hydrogen carrier, the system will offer integrated monitoring and control capabilities for all onboard equipment, alongside critical emergency shutdown functions.
For freight forwarders and logistics professionals, this development signals a continued trend towards decarbonization in the maritime sector. The introduction of more hydrogen-fueled vessels, especially large carriers, could lead to the expansion of green shipping corridors and the availability of lower-emission transport options in the future. While immediate impacts on rates or capacity are unlikely, it represents a long-term shift that may influence vessel choices and supply chain sustainability strategies.
